Secretariat- The 1 1/4 event for 3 year olds fillies on the grass . 4 horses to use in this one. You might be able to get away with not using Secret Getaway, but I’ll put her in. Winchester, Plan and Tizdejavu. Winchester ships in with Plan from Ireland. These two don’t look to be the strongest euros to ship in, but this race is not packed with big horses. Winchester has won at a 1 1/4 in Ireland and will use lasix and blinkers for the first time. Plan owned by IEAH of Big Brown fame and Team Tabor from Ireland. Murtagh from Ireland will ride. Her time form numbers have improved with each race she has run. Will try the 1 1/4 for the first time. And Secret Getaway coming off back to back wins at Woodbine, but also ran a game 2nd at the class filled Keeneland meet to Accredit.

Beverly D- Lots of class in here, but the question is who will get the distance. It looks like the front end will be crowded early with Dreaming of Ana, Rosinka and Precious Kitten. They are all class, but will they stay on late? Mauralakana has won at the distance of a 1 3/16 and is sharp form for Clement. She always put in a strong late rally. French filly Cicerole stretches out. Horse has never won beyond a 1 1/16, but the horse always run a good race. She has defeated colts in France. Has never contested a race better then a G3…Connections see fit to make it today. She might be a surprise.

Arlington Million- Archipenko is starting to get better and better. Big time form ratings and won the Queen Elizabeth Cup. Spirit One is another french invader. Has run some solid races in France and is a winner at a 1 1/4. Ran right behind the top rated Euro Duke Of Maramalade in a gutsy effort. If turf is less then firm this one should appreciate it. Einstein one of the top American based horses this year. Has never won at a 1 1/4, but is in solid form for this. And team Tabor shows up with Mount Nelson coming off a GI win in the Eclipse Stakes. Murtagh sees fit to come over and ride him for this. Ran right behind the top rated filly Darjina.
